Glendale Takes Second Game from Citrus

Citrus College couldn't keep No. 5 Glendale College in check, falling 12-2 Thursday afternoon.
The Owls drop to 14-14 on the year and 7-4 in the Western State Conference. The Vaqueros hold onto their undefeated conference record and improve to 22-5 overall.
Only three Owls were able to get hits in the game: Conner McKinney, Dillon Swim and Diego Gonzales.
Citrus finally broke through the scoreless drought in the sixth inning on a two-out rally. With Robert Valdivia on second, Swim came in to pinch hit and knocked a hard infield single and Valdivia turned on the jets to put the Owls on the board. Swim then stole second and came home on Gonzales' RBI double down the left-field line.
The Owls and Vaqueros close out the series in Glendale on Saturday at 1 p.m.
